===== Creating a Snap Archive ===== | ===== Creating a Snap Archive ===== |
| |
Most AIX systems come pre-installed with a helpful utility called [[https://www.ibm.com/support/knowledgecenter/en/ssw_aix_72/com.ibm.aix.cmds5/snap.htm|snap]] which is a command line tool to create a diagnostic bundle. This has most (not all) of the technical information one needs to troubleshoot an AIX system. In order to create a snap archive, use the command **snap -ac** which will deposit an archive in **/tmp/ibmsupt/snap.pax.Z**. We will need this archive for problem determination.
